Hebrew word
maʻălâh
mah-al-aw'
מַעֲלָה
What it means
elevation, i.e. the act, or the condition
elevation, i.e. the act (literally, a journey to a higher place, figuratively, a thought arising), or (concretely) the condition (literally, a step or grademark, figuratively, a superiority of station); specifically a climactic progression (in certain Psalms)
Where it comes from
feminine of maʻăleh (מַעֲלֶה)
